Honeywell C-Wire Adapter: Installation and Compatibility Guide

The Honeywell C-Wire Adapter addresses the need for a common (C) wire when installing thermostats, particularly in systems where one is not originally present. This adapter facilitates power delivery to thermostats, ensuring compatibility with both Wi-Fi and non-Wi-Fi Honeywell models. The device is designed for relatively straightforward installation and aims to simplify the upgrade process for users seeking to modernize their home climate control systems. This article details the adapter’s function, compatibility considerations, and installation procedures based on available documentation.

Understanding the C-Wire Requirement

Many modern thermostats, including those offered by Honeywell, require a continuous power supply to operate correctly. This power is typically provided through a common wire, often designated as “C.” Older HVAC systems may not include a C-wire, presenting a challenge when upgrading to a smart or advanced thermostat. The Honeywell C-Wire Adapter is engineered to resolve this issue by effectively creating a C-wire connection without requiring extensive rewiring of the HVAC system. The adapter functions as a power source for the thermostat, enabling consistent operation and communication.

Compatibility Verification

Prior to installation, verifying compatibility is crucial. The documentation specifies that the C-Wire Adapter is designed for use with Honeywell thermostats. It is essential to confirm that the existing HVAC wiring includes both a G and a Y wire. The presence of both these wires indicates system compatibility with the adapter. If both G and Y wires are not present, the system is not compatible, and the adapter should not be installed. The adapter is specifically intended for situations where a C-wire is not already available for connection to the thermostat.

Installation Procedure

The installation process involves several steps, beginning with safety precautions. It is consistently emphasized throughout the documentation to ensure the power to the HVAC system is turned off before commencing any work.

  1. Accessing the Control Board: The first step involves opening the cover of the furnace or heating system to access the control board. This may require unscrewing the cover, either from the top or bottom.
  2. Locating Existing Wires: Once the cover is removed, locate the bundle of wires that correspond to those connected to the thermostat.
  3. Connecting Wires to the Adapter: The C-Wire Adapter features terminals labeled for both the “Thermostat” and “Equipment” sides. Wires labeled from the thermostat side should be firmly pressed into the corresponding terminals on the adapter. Similarly, wires originating from the equipment side should be connected to the appropriate terminals on the adapter. It is important to ensure a secure connection by gently tugging on the wires after insertion.
  4. Mounting the Adapter: The adapter includes a magnetic mount and adhesive pad for secure placement inside the furnace or heating system. Before mounting, the surface should be cleaned to ensure proper adhesion. The adhesive pad should be firmly pressed onto the cleaned surface, and the adapter then mounted onto the pad. Care should be taken to avoid overextending or straining the wires during this process.
  5. Closing the System Cover: After the adapter is securely mounted and all connections are verified, the cover of the furnace or heating system should be closed completely. The documentation notes that some systems may not power up if the cover is not fully closed.
  6. Restoring Power: Once the cover is securely closed, the power to the HVAC system can be restored.

Troubleshooting Common Issues

The documentation addresses potential issues that may arise during or after installation. One common problem is a thermostat that fails to turn on or respond. In such cases, the documentation recommends checking the C-Wire Adapter installation to ensure it is properly connected to both the thermostat and the heating/cooling system. It also advises verifying that the power supply is functioning correctly and that all connections are tight.

Another potential issue is a thermostat not receiving power from the adapter. The documentation suggests consulting the thermostat’s user manual or Honeywell’s website to confirm compatibility with the C-Wire Adapter. Ensuring the specific thermostat model supports the adapter is essential.

Adapter Specifications and Features

The Honeywell C-Wire Power Adapter (model THP9045A2098/U) is designed for quick and easy installation. It features push terminals for simplified wire connections and a magnetic mount for convenient placement. The closed cover design conceals the internal components, providing a neat and organized installation. The adapter is constructed from high-quality materials to ensure reliable performance and longevity. It is specifically engineered for seamless integration with Honeywell thermostats, supporting both Wi-Fi and non-Wi-Fi models.
